: Recent editions include dedicated chapters on Outsourcing ,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R), and e-procurement systems to reflect today's digital landscape. “Procurement is not just buying something

: It integrates the "Five Rights" of procurement (Right Quality, Quantity, Time, Price, and Source) with practical case studies and "research boxes" that link academic findings to industry reality.
